Die zunehmende Digitalisierung und die Beliebtheit von Online-Casinos machen mobile Anwendungen zu einem zentralen Bestandteil der Glücksspielbranche. Doch mit der steigenden Nutzung gehen auch erhöhte Sicherheitsrisiken einher. Für Betreiber und Nutzer ist es essenziell, Sicherheitslücken frühzeitig zu erkennen und zu vermeiden, um Betrug, Datenlecks und rechtliche Konsequenzen zu verhindern. In diesem Artikel werden die wichtigsten Schwachstellen in Casino Apps analysiert, praktische Prüfmethoden vorgestellt und bewährte Sicherheitsmaßnahmen erläutert.
Inhaltsverzeichnis
- Typische Schwachstellen in der Softwareentwicklung von Casino Apps identifizieren
- Praktische Methoden zur Sicherheitsüberprüfung vor der App-Veröffentlichung
- Verschlüsselungstechniken zur Absicherung sensibler Informationen
- Risiken durch unzureichendes User-Management und Authentifizierung
- Praktische Ansätze zur Erkennung von Sicherheitslücken im laufenden Betrieb
Typische Schwachstellen in der Softwareentwicklung von Casino Apps identifizieren
Unzureichende Verschlüsselung sensibler Daten und deren Risiken
Viele Casino Apps vernachlässigen die Implementierung starker Verschlüsselung bei der Speicherung und Übertragung sensibler Nutzerdaten. Beispielsweise greifen einige Entwickler noch immer auf veraltete Algorithmen wie DES oder RC4 zurück, die bereits als unsicher gelten. Diese Schwachstellen ermöglichen es Angreifern, Daten wie Kontoinformationen, Zahlungsdetails und persönliche Daten abzufangen oder zu manipulieren. Laut einer Studie des OWASP (Open Web Application Security Project) ist die Verschlüsselung ein Schlüsselbestandteil, um Datenintegrität und Vertraulichkeit zu gewährleisten.
Fehlende Sicherheitsüberprüfungen bei Zahlungsprozessen
Zahlungsvorgänge stellen das Herzstück jeder Casino App dar. Schwachstellen in der Zahlungsabwicklung, etwa unzureichende Validierung von Transaktionen oder mangelnde Secure Payment Gateways, eröffnen Betrügern Lücken. In einigen Fällen fehlen Mehrstufige Verifizierungsprozesse, was das Risiko von Betrugsversuchen erhöht. Studien zeigen, dass unsichere Zahlungsprozesse häufig durch mangelnde Sicherheitsüberprüfungen und unzureichende Verschlüsselung ausgenutzt werden.
Schwachstellen in Authentifizierungs- und Sitzungsmanagement
Ein häufig unterschätztes Risiko liegt in der Authentifizierung und dem Sitzungsmanagement. Unsichere Implementierungen, etwa einfache Passwörter, fehlende Mehrfaktor-Authentifizierung oder schwache Session-Timeouts, erlauben Angreifern, unbefugt Zugriff zu erlangen. Besonders problematisch ist Session-Hijacking, bei dem Angreifer die Sitzung eines legitimierten Nutzers übernehmen. Hier zeigen Untersuchungen, dass etwa 60 % der Sicherheitsverletzungen in Apps auf Schwachstellen im Session-Management zurückzuführen sind.
Praktische Methoden zur Sicherheitsüberprüfung vor der App-Veröffentlichung
Penetrationstests und ihre Anwendung bei Casino Apps
Penetrationstests sind kontrollierte Angriffe auf die eigene Software, um Sicherheitslücken aufzudecken. Bei Casino Apps sollten diese Tests von erfahrenen Sicherheitsexperten durchgeführt werden, die gezielt Schwachstellen in Authentifizierung, Datenübertragung und Zahlungsprozessen identifizieren. Studien belegen, dass Unternehmen, die regelmäßige Penetrationstests durchführen, ihre Sicherheitslage signifikant verbessern und Risiken minimieren.
Automatisierte Sicherheitsscans: Tools und Grenzen
Automatisierte Tools wie OWASP ZAP oder Burp Suite erleichtern die schnelle Überprüfung auf bekannte Schwachstellen. Diese Tools scannen nach unsicheren Konfigurationen, veralteten Bibliotheken oder bekannten Angriffspunkten. Dennoch sind sie keine Allheilmittel: Komplexe Sicherheitslücken, speziell im Zusammenhang mit Logikfehlern oder in der App-Architektur, erfordern menschliche Analyse und tiefergehende Penetrationstests.
Code-Reviews mit Fokus auf Sicherheitslücken
Ein systematisches Code-Review hilft, Sicherheitsmängel frühzeitig zu erkennen. Entwickler sollten bei der Überprüfung besonderes Augenmerk auf sichere Programmierpraktiken legen, z.B. Eingabefilterung, sichere Speicherung von Passwörtern und richtige Nutzung von Verschlüsselung. Für zusätzliche Sicherheit können rodeoslot slots eine interessante Ergänzung sein. Laut Fachkreisen erhöht ein regelmäßiges Code-Review die Sicherheitsresilienz der Anwendung deutlich.
Verschlüsselungstechniken zur Absicherung sensibler Informationen
Implementierung starker Verschlüsselungsprotokolle (z.B. SSL/TLS)
Der Einsatz aktueller Verschlüsselungsprotokolle wie TLS 1.3 ist unerlässlich, um die Kommunikation zwischen Nutzer und Server zu sichern. Studien belegen, dass veraltete Protokolle wie SSL 3.0 oder TLS 1.0 anfällig für Man-in-the-Middle-Angriffe sind. Moderne Implementierungen gewährleisten, dass alle Datenübertragungen verschlüsselt und vor Abhörversuchen geschützt sind.
Nutzen von Verschlüsselung bei Nutzerdaten und Transaktionen
Sensible Daten sollten immer verschlüsselt gespeichert werden, idealerweise mit Algorithmen wie AES-256. Bei Transaktionen helfen digitale Signaturen und HMACs, die Integrität und Authentizität zu gewährleisten. Ein Beispiel: Die Verwendung von End-to-End-Verschlüsselung bei Zahlungsdaten schützt vor unbefugtem Zugriff während der Übertragung.
Schwachstellen bei veralteten Verschlüsselungsmethoden vermeiden
Die Verwendung veralteter Algorithmen oder unsicherer Schlüssellängen stellt eine erhebliche Gefahr dar. Beispielsweise sind 40-Bit-Schlüssel heute nicht mehr ausreichend. Es ist wichtig, regelmäßige Sicherheitsupdates durchzuführen und nur moderne, bewährte Verschlüsselungstechnologien zu verwenden. Die Aktualisierung der Kryptografie ist eine Grundvoraussetzung für die Sicherheit in Casino Apps.
Risiken durch unzureichendes User-Management und Authentifizierung
Mehrfaktor-Authentifizierung in Casino Apps integrieren
Mehrfaktor-Authentifizierung (MFA) erhöht die Sicherheit erheblich, indem sie eine zweite Verifikationsebene wie Einmal-Codes, biometrische Daten oder Hardware-Token verlangt. Laut Sicherheitsforschern reduziert MFA das Risiko von Account-Übernahmen um bis zu 90 %. Für Casino Apps bedeutet dies, dass Nutzer zusätzlich zu ihrem Passwort einen temporären Code eingeben müssen, um Zugriff zu erhalten.
Schwachstellen bei Passwortmanagement erkennen
Viele Nutzer verwenden schwache Passwörter oder wiederholen sie auf mehreren Plattformen. Entwickler sollten sichere Passwortanforderungen setzen, z.B. Mindestlänge, Groß- und Kleinbuchstaben, Zahlen und Sonderzeichen. Zudem ist die Implementierung von Passwort-Hashing-Algorithmen wie bcrypt oder Argon2 essenziell, um gespeicherte Passwörter vor Diebstahl zu schützen.
Session-Hijacking und Schutzmaßnahmen
Session-Hijacking erfolgt, wenn Angreifer die Sitzung eines Nutzers übernehmen. Schutzmaßnahmen umfassen die Verwendung sicherer Cookies, kurze Session-Timeouts und die Überprüfung der IP-Adresse bei jeder Anfrage. Zudem sollten Entwickler auf HTTPS setzen, um Session-Daten vor Abfangung zu bewahren.
Praktische Ansätze zur Erkennung von Sicherheitslücken im laufenden Betrieb
Monitoring-Tools für ungewöhnliche Aktivitäten
Aktives Monitoring hilft, verdächtige Aktivitäten frühzeitig zu erkennen. Tools wie SIEM-Systeme (Security Information and Event Management) sammeln und analysieren Log-Daten in Echtzeit. Anomalien wie plötzliche Login-Versuche oder ungewöhnliche Transaktionsmuster sind Anzeichen für mögliche Angriffe.
Incident Response und Sofortmaßnahmen bei Sicherheitsvorfällen
Ein strukturierter Incident-Response-Plan ist essenziell. Bei Sicherheitsvorfällen sollten sofort Maßnahmen ergriffen werden, z.B. Sperrung betroffener Konten, Analyse der Angriffsmethoden und Benachrichtigung der Nutzer. Schnelles Handeln minimiert Schäden und stärkt das Vertrauen der Nutzer.
Regelmäßige Sicherheitsupdates und Patches
Angreifer nutzen häufig bekannte Schwachstellen in veralteter Software aus. Daher ist es wichtig, alle Systeme, Bibliotheken und Frameworks regelmäßig zu aktualisieren. Die Implementierung eines automatisierten Patch-Managements sorgt dafür, dass Sicherheitslücken schnell geschlossen werden.
Fazit: Die Sicherheit in Casino Apps ist ein komplexes, fortlaufendes Thema. Durch die Kombination aus präventiven Maßnahmen, regelmäßigen Prüfungen und modernen Verschlüsselungstechnologien können Betreiber das Risiko von Sicherheitslücken minimieren und das Vertrauen ihrer Nutzer nachhaltig stärken.